Review of the EB5 Immigrant Capitalist Program



The EB5 Immigrant Capitalist Program, established by the united state government in 1990, aims to promote the economic climate through international investments. This program permits qualified foreign nationals to acquire united state long-term residency by purchasing a united state service that preserves or develops at least ten full-time tasks for American workers. The initiative was created to bring in foreign funding to improve financial growth and develop job possibilities within the country. Capitalists can participate via regional centers or straight investments in companies, supplying flexibility in how they add. The program offers as a path for people seeking to live in the USA while concurrently sustaining local economic climates. Because of this, it has ended up being a preferred option for those seeking to spend in the united state market while guaranteeing conformity with migration regulations. Generally, the EB5 program mirrors a strategic method to leveraging foreign financial investment for residential development.

Definition of TEAs



Targeted Employment Locations (TEAs) play a vital role in the EB-5 Immigrant Capitalist Program by assigning details regions that need financial excitement. These locations are determined based upon joblessness rates or populace thickness, indicating a need for financial investments to boost neighborhood economic situations. TEAs can be identified into 2 groups: high-unemployment areas, where the joblessness price is at least 150% of the nationwide standard, and rural areas, defined as areas outside of municipal analytical areas with a populace of 20,000 or much less. By urging investments in TEAs, the EB-5 program aims to produce tasks and promote economic advancement in regions that might have a hard time without such support, inevitably benefiting both investors and regional areas.

Task Development Requirements for EB5 Investors



To get the EB-5 Immigrant Capitalist Program, financiers should satisfy particular job development demands that demonstrate their payment to the united state economic situation. Each EB-5 financier is accountable for developing or maintaining a minimum of ten permanent tasks for U.S. workers within two years of the investor's application. These work should be direct, suggesting they are straight produced by the company in which the capitalist has actually invested.


In instances where investors choose to buy a Targeted Employment Area (TEA), indirect job creation can also be thought about, however the main emphasis stays on straight employment. The job development demand is an essential metric for evaluating the effect of the investment on regional communities and the nationwide economic situation. It is necessary for financiers to keep extensive documentation, as the U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Provider (USCIS) rigorously examines compliance with these demands throughout the application process.

Application Refine and Timeline for EB5 Investors



Understanding the application process and timeline for EB-5 investors is essential for those seeking to navigate the intricacies of acquiring a united state visa with investment. The process typically starts with selecting a suitable local facility or project, followed by the prep work of the Type I-526, which outlines the financial investment strategy and shows the resource of funds. This kind is submitted to the united state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S)


As soon as filed, the I-526 application can take numerous months to process, usually ranging from 6 to year - EB5 requirements for investors. Upon authorization, investors can make an application for conditional permanent residency via the Type I-485 or the DS-260 for those outside the U.S. This action includes extra documentation and might take an additional 6 to one year. After two years, capitalists must file the Type I-829 to eliminate problems on their residency, marking the conclusion of the EB-5 process
